MK Gafni: Education Ministry and Court `Declaring War' on Torah-Based Education
By Yechiel Sever

Finance Committee Chairman MK Rabbi Moshe Gafni fired a stiff attack against the Education Ministry and the court, which have been closing ranks to thwart the success of the Torah-based education system, making every effort to undermine Torah-true educational frameworks.

Efforts to Save Jaffa Cemetery Continue
By Yechiel Sever

A rally was held Wednesday to pray, protest and express grief over the evil decree to raze the ancient Jewish cemetery in Jaffa. Gedolei Torah, admorim and rabbonim stood opposite the site, invoking the words of Selichos — "Aseh lema'an shochnei offor" — in impassioned calls against plans by the project heads and government authorities to continue harming Jewish graves at an additional site in the cemetery.


Rabbi Maklev Defends Conversion `Stringencies' in IDF
By Eliezer Rauchberger

Opponents of halachic conversion "cannot strike fear in the hearts of rabbonim and dayonim, who will continue to perform conversions only in accordance with halacha as handed down to us from Mt. Sinai," said MK Rabbi Uri Maklev this week in a meeting of the Knesset's State Control Committee on the issue of conversion in the IDF.

A Great Man's Prayers

Rav Dovid Zimmerman relates: "One Hoshanoh Rabba towards the end of our master's life, a childless avreich arrived at his succah. He and his wife had not had a child for almost twenty years. Our master was in a good mood and even though he usually avoided giving blessings — and would sometimes argue and bargain before agreeing to do so — the attitude he took towards them during Succos was different to that of the rest of the year.
